phpWebSite Foren-Übersicht    
  Navigation •  FAQ  •  Suchen  •  Benutzergruppen  •  Registrieren  •  Profil  •  Einloggen, um private Nachrichten zu lesen  •  Login

 Nach Installation...

Neues Thema eröffnenNeue Antwort erstellen
Autor Nachricht
erhard
Newbie
Newbie





Anmeldungsdatum: 08.12.2009
Beiträge: 1


germany.gif

BeitragVerfasst am: Mi 09 Dez, 2009 8:22    Nach Installation... Antworten mit ZitatNach oben

Moinsen, liebe Gemeinde,
Als "Neuer" hier im Forum habe ich gleich mal ein kleines Problem: Question

Nach Installation (version 0.11), erfolgreicher Anlage aller Tabellen und abschließendem Klick auf den Link unten auf der Install-page erhalte ich folgende Fehlermeldung:
----------------------------------------------
"CNT_stats", "transfer_var"=>"body"); $layout_info[] = array ("content_var"=>"CNT_stats_block", "transfer_var"=>"right_col_mid"); ?>
Fatal error: Cannot re-assign $this in D:\xampp\htdocs\phpws\mod\article\class\Article.php on line 723
----------------------------------------------
Das sieht mir doch arg nach
a) einem Coding-Fehler oder
b) Rechtefehler

aus.

Könnte mir da mal jemand auf die Sprünge helfen?

9.Dezember:
Nachdem ich ein wenig auf Fehlersuche gegangen bin, scheint mir der Ursprung des Ganzen in der PAER.PHP zu liegen:

Folgende Fehlerausgabe kommt hoch, wenn ich auf die Admin-Seite gehe:

Erst jede Menge "Deprecated-Warnungen", dann :
------------------------------------------------------------------
Warning: session_start() [function.session-start]: Cannot send session cache limiter - headers already sent (output started at D:\xampp\htdocs\phpws\lib\pear\PEAR.php:540) in D:\xampp\htdocs\phpws\core\Core.php on line 308
------------------------------------------------------------------

Irgendwie scheint der redirect mittels "Location: header()" nicht zu funktionieren.
Nun bin ich allerdings noch nicht so gut in PHP, um beurteilen zu können, ob es sich hierbei um einen Bug in der Version 5.3.0 handelt oder ob dies ein Coding-Fehler ist.

In der Core.php ist das System auf Windows eingestellt:

/*******************************************************************************************
 *                         Do NOT edit anything above this point!                          *
 ********************************** BEGIN - USER EDIT **************************************/

/* This line is for *nix/linux environments */
//ini_set('include_path', '.' . PATH_SEPARATOR . PHPWS_SOURCE_DIR . 'lib/pear/');


// Fixes validator warnings for the hidden sessions
ini_set("url_rewriter.tags", "a=href,area=href,fieldset=fakeentry");

/* This line is for windows environments */
ini_set('include_path', '.' . PATH_SEPARATOR . PHPWS_SOURCE_DIR . 'lib\\pear\\');

/* Uncomment this line to attempt to use a higher memory limit */
ini_set('memory_limit', '16M');

/* Change the argument separator for XHTML compatibility */
ini_set('arg_separator.output', '&');

/********************************* END - USER EDIT ****************************************
 *                         Do NOT edit anything below this point!                         *
 ******************************************************************************************/


Falls noch irgendwelche Infos benötigt werden: einfach Bescheid sagen...

System:
PC, WIN XP PRO
PHP 5.3.0
Apache 2.2.12
MYSQL 5.3.7

Besten Dank im Voraus,
Erhard

_________________
MiniRails.de

OfflineBenutzer-Profile anzeigenPrivate Nachricht senden    
christian
Administrator
Administrator




Alter: 45
Anmeldungsdatum: 19.01.2002
Beiträge: 1930
Wohnort: Augsburg


germany.gif

BeitragVerfasst am: So 13 Dez, 2009 11:26    (Kein Titel) Antworten mit ZitatNach oben

Hallo Erhard,

da du Windows als Testumgebung hast, muß ich zugeben - Windows Server hab ich noch nie versucht.

Bei Dir kommt noch zum tragen, dass DU XAAMP hast.
Das wiederum eine geringe Abweichung gegenüber eines Windows Servers darstellt.

Was passiert, wenn DU die Angabe zu PEAR direkt eintragung tust?

Oder mal statt:

/* This line is for windows environments */
ini_set('include_path', '.' . PATH_SEPARATOR . PHPWS_SOURCE_DIR . 'lib\\pear\\');


/* This line is for windows environments */
ini_set('include_path', '.' . PATH_SEPARATOR . PHPWS_SOURCE_DIR . 'lib\pear\');

Zwei \\ finde ich komisch !

Gruss Christian

_________________
~OO~OO_ Christian _OO~OO~
http://www.phpws.de & http://www.phpwebsite.eu
Webhosting : http://phpwebsite-hosting.de
Tel.: 0180 5 301100-00
(nur 0,14€ aus dem Netz der deutschen Telekom, Mobilfunk abweichende Preise)

OfflineBenutzer-Profile anzeigenPrivate Nachricht sendenWebsite dieses Benutzers besuchen    
Beiträge der letzten Zeit anzeigen:      
Neues Thema eröffnenNeue Antwort erstellen


 Gehe zu:   



Berechtigungen anzeigen


Forensicherheit

Alle Zeiten sind GMT + 1 Stunde
Converted by U.K. Forumimages
Powered by Orion based on phpBB © 2001, 2002 phpBB Group :: FI Theme ::edit by MS::

[ Page generation time: 0.0764s (PHP: 90% - SQL: 10%) | SQL queries: 14 | GZIP enabled | Debug on ]